Capacity note for the Duskrelay broker upgrade, for support awareness. The move to version 7 changes default queue depths and consumer prefetch, so some tenants may see different backlog behavior during the cutover weekend. Expect brief redelivery spikes while partitions rebalance; no customer action needed. The new broker tuning constants, for reference when triaging tickets, are as follows.

tuning constants:
QUOTAS = {
    "druwyn": 5,
    "holix": 5,
    "zorath": 5,
    "holwyn": 10,
}

Subject: DR Drill Friday — Ledgerwick Conversion Service

Welcome, new folks. This Friday we rehearse restoring the Ledgerwick currency converter after a simulated region loss. Pay special attention to the rounding-error reconciliation step: restored balances may drift by fractions of a cent until the half-even rounding job reruns, so compare totals only after it completes. To unlock the sealed restore bundle during the drill, use the passphrase below.

unlock words, bajof-yajep: sorwyn-holdor-gilix

## Release Runbook — GridFeed CSV Import Wizard

Quick one for plugin folks: before you push a wizard release, run the GridFeed packer, tag the build, and sign the bundle — unsigned builds get bounced by the Marrowby channel. Don't reuse old tags, the packer hates it. Sign your release bundle with the key below.

rollout seal: bky4_x7Gc